Understanding the Kitchen Remodel Process

Kitchen remodels are complex. They involve many steps. Understanding these steps helps in planning. It also helps in managing your expectations.

1. Planning And Design

The first step is planning. You decide what changes you want. Do you want new cabinets? Or maybe a new floor? This step can take 2 to 4 weeks.

In this time, you may talk to a designer. They help turn your ideas into a plan. You will also set a budget during this phase.

2. Getting Permits

Some changes need permits. These are special permissions from the city. Getting permits can take 2 to 4 weeks. It depends on where you live.

Not every remodel needs permits. But, it is important to check. Your contractor can help with this.

3. Demolition

Once plans are ready, demolition starts. Old cabinets and counters are removed. This part is noisy and messy.

Demolition usually takes 1 to 2 weeks. It depends on the size of the kitchen. It also depends on how much is being changed.

4. Structural Changes

Some remodels need structural changes. This means moving walls or plumbing. These changes take time. Structural work can take 1 to 3 weeks.

Not all remodels need this step. If no walls are moved, this step is skipped.

5. Electrical And Plumbing

After structure comes wiring and plumbing. Electricians and plumbers do this work. They may add new outlets or move pipes.

This step takes 1 to 2 weeks. It ensures your kitchen works safely and correctly.

6. Installing New Features

Now it is time for new features. This includes cabinets, counters, and appliances. Each part needs careful installation.

Installing new features can take 1 to 3 weeks. It depends on how many new items you have.

7. Finishing Touches

The last step is finishing touches. This includes painting and flooring. It also includes installing lighting and fixtures.

Finishing touches take 1 to 2 weeks. They make your kitchen look complete.

Step Duration
Planning and Design 2-4 weeks
Getting Permits 2-4 weeks
Demolition 1-2 weeks
Structural Changes 1-3 weeks
Electrical and Plumbing 1-2 weeks
Installing New Features 1-3 weeks
Finishing Touches 1-2 weeks

Factors Affecting Remodel Time

Several factors affect how long a remodel takes. Each kitchen is different. Let’s look at these factors.

Size Of The Kitchen

Big kitchens take longer to remodel. More space means more work. Small kitchens are quicker. But, they can still be complex.

Complexity Of Design

Simple designs are faster. Complex designs take more time. Adding special features can add weeks to the project.

Contractor Schedule

Your contractor’s schedule affects time. Busy contractors might take longer. It’s important to plan ahead.

Material Availability

Some materials take time to arrive. Custom items can take weeks to be ready. If materials are delayed, the project takes longer.

Unexpected Delays

Sometimes, delays happen. Weather, supply issues, or hidden problems can arise. Planning for these helps reduce stress.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Long Does A Kitchen Remodel Take?

A kitchen remodel can take 6 to 12 weeks. It depends on size and complexity.

What Factors Affect Kitchen Remodel Time?

Kitchen size, design changes, and contractor availability. These factors can extend the timeline significantly.

Is A Diy Kitchen Remodel Faster?

DIY remodels may take longer. Skills and experience play a big role in timing.

Can Kitchen Remodels Be Done In Phases?

Yes, doing remodels in phases is possible. It can help manage time and budget.
